Inspect Water Usage



Analyze your water bills and track your water consumption. As the one paying it, you must see if there are any inconsistencies. If you spot sudden changes, regardless of your usage coinciding, it means that you have leakages in your plumbing system. Bear in mind, your water expense ought to drop under the exact same variety monthly. An unexpected spike in your costs suggests a fast-moving leak.

A constant increase every month, also with the same practices, shows you have a slow-moving leak that's likewise gradually intensifying. Call a plumber to completely check your property, particularly if you really feel a warm area on your flooring with piping underneath.

Examine the Water Meter



Every home has a water meter. Checking it is a proven way that assists you uncover leaks. For beginners, turn off all the water sources. Make sure no person will flush, utilize the tap, shower, run the washing device or dishwasher. From there, go to the meter and watch if it will certainly alter. Given that no one is using it, there need to be no movements. That suggests a fast-moving leak if it relocates. If you detect no adjustments, wait an hour or two and also inspect back once again. This implies you might have a slow-moving leak that can even be underground.

Signs You Have a Hidden Plumbing Leak


Damaged floors, walls, or ceilings


Water-damaged floors, walls, and ceilings are often warped, sagging, drooping, or covered in stains. You might also notice that the paint is chipping off of your walls due to water coming into contact with and separating the paint from the wall surface.




Extra-green patches of grass


Because pipes are often underground, it is not uncommon for a leak to affect your lawn. If you find that a certain area of your grass is growing faster than other areas of your lawn, there might just be an underground leak.




Higher-than-usual water bills


If your water bill is much too high each month, and it doesn’t seem to match up with your actual water usage, something is definitely up with your system.


Continuously running meter


Your water meter should not be running all of the time. If you turn off all running water in your home and your water meter still shows that water is running, there is a leak somewhere in your system.
